Safran Slowly Progresses Toward Open-Rotor Testing

Lyon, France—Safran Aircraft Engines is planning to test a counter-rotating open-rotor (CROR) engine demonstrator in Istres, France, “in the coming months,” attributing the slow progress to challenges in design and manufacturing. Assembly of the demonstrator will be completed soon in Vernon, in...
